Company overview

Charles Schwab is a leading financial services firm that provides a wide range of investment, banking, and advisory services. Founded in 1971 by Charles R. Schwab, the company revolutionized the brokerage industry by offering discounted stock trades. Today, it generates revenue through trading commissions, asset management fees, and banking services. Key milestones include the acquisition of TD Ameritrade in 2020, which significantly expanded its client base and technological capabilities. The company is known for its customer-centric approach and innovative financial products.
